1) Pueraria montana (Lour.) Merr. is the name of a plant defined in various botanical sources. This page contains potential references in modern medicine, Ayurveda, and other local traditions or folk medicine. It has the following synonyms: Dolichos montana Lour., Dolichos montanus Lour., Glycine javanica L., Pachyrhizus montanus (Lour.) DC., Pueraria lobata (Willd.) Ohwi var. montana (Lour.) Maesen, Pueraria omeiensis T. Tang & Wang, Pueraria thunbergiana (Siebold & Zucc.) Benth. var. formosana Hosok., Pueraria tonkinensis Gagnep., Stizolobium montanum (Lour.) Spreng., Zeydora agrestis Gomes.

2) Pueraria montana (Lour.) Merr. var. lobata (Willd.) Sanjappa & Pradeep is another plant having the following synonyms: Dolichos hirsutus Thunb., Dolichos japonicus hort., Dolichos lobatus Willd., Neustanthus chinensis Benth., Pachyrhizus thunbergianus Siebold & Zucc., Phaseolus trilobus (L.) Aiton, Pueraria argyi H. Lev. & Vaniot, Pueraria bodinieri H. Lev. & Vaniot, Pueraria caerulea H. Lev. & Vaniot, Pueraria harmsii Rech., Pueraria hirsuta (Thunb.) Matsum., nom. illeg., Pueraria koten H. Lev. & Vaniot, Pueraria lobata (Willd.) Ohwi, Pueraria lobata (Willd.) Ohwi subsp. lobata (Willd.) Ohwi, Pueraria montana var. lobata (Willd.) Maesen & S.M. Almeida, Pueraria montana var. lobata (Willd.) Maesen & S.M. Almeida ex Sanjappa & Pradeep, Pueraria neo-caledonica Harms, Pueraria novo-guineensis Warb., Pueraria pseudohirsuta T. Tang & Wang, Pueraria thunbergiana (Siebold & Zucc.) Benth., Pueraria triloba (Houtt.) Makino, Pueraria volkensii Hosok..
